1. Define Your Hypothesis and Key Metric
Before you even think about crafting a notification, you need a clear hypothesis. This isn’t just good practice; it’s non-negotiable for meaningful A/B testing. Your hypothesis should be a testable statement predicting how a specific change will affect your key metric. For push notifications, that key metric is almost always the click-through rate (CTR).
For example, a strong hypothesis might be: “Adding a personalized first name to the notification title will increase CTR by at least 15% compared to a generic title.” Or, “Using an urgent call to action like ‘Act Now!’ will outperform ‘Learn More’ by 10% in promotional push notifications.” This clarity prevents aimless testing and ensures every experiment yields actionable insights.
Pro Tip: Don’t try to test everything at once. Focus on one element per test: either the headline, the body copy, the call to action, the emoji usage, or the timing. Simultaneous changes make it impossible to pinpoint what truly drove the performance difference.
2. Segment Your Audience Strategically
Sending the same push notification to everyone is like shouting into a crowd and hoping someone listens. Effective A/B testing requires thoughtful audience segmentation. You wouldn’t show an offer for baby products to a user who’s only ever browsed electronics, would you?
I always start by segmenting users based on their behavior within the app or website. For instance, you might have segments for “recent purchasers,” “abandoned cart users,” “inactive users (last seen 30+ days ago),” or “users who viewed Product Category X but didn’t buy.” Demographic data can also be powerful, especially for location-specific campaigns. For a local retailer in Atlanta, I might segment users who have opted into location services and are within a 5-mile radius of their Peachtree Street store versus those in Alpharetta. This ensures your test results are relevant to the specific user group you’re trying to influence.
Common Mistakes: Over-segmenting your audience to the point where your test groups are too small to achieve statistical significance. Conversely, testing on too broad an audience can dilute results and mask the true impact on specific, valuable user cohorts.
3. Craft Your Variations (A and B)
Now, it’s time to create your notification variants based on your hypothesis. Remember, we’re only changing one core element. Let’s say our hypothesis is that emojis increase CTR. We’ll keep everything else constant.
- Variant A (Control): “Flash Sale: Up to 50% off all summer apparel. Shop now!”
- Variant B (Test): “Flash Sale: Up to 50% off all summer apparel! ☀️ Shop now! 👇”
Notice how only the emojis are different. The core message, offer, and call to action remain identical. For a more advanced test, perhaps you’re testing urgency in the call to action:
- Variant A (Control): “New arrivals just dropped! Explore our latest collection.”
- Variant B (Test): “Limited Stock Alert! New arrivals selling fast. Grab yours before they’re gone!”
Tools like Braze, OneSignal, or Firebase Cloud Messaging (FCM) all offer intuitive interfaces for setting up these variations. Within Braze, for example, you’d navigate to your campaign, select “Create New Message,” choose “Push Notification,” and then select the “A/B Test” option. You’ll specify your control group (Variant A) and then add your variant(s) (Variant B, C, etc.).
4. Configure Your A/B Test in Your Platform
The technical setup is where the rubber meets the road. I’ve seen countless tests botched here due to incorrect configuration.
Most modern push notification platforms have robust A/B testing capabilities. Here’s a general workflow you’d follow, using a hypothetical platform interface:
- Select A/B Test Option: After drafting your message, look for an “A/B Test” or “Experiment” toggle or section.
- Define Distribution: You’ll typically specify the percentage of your target audience that receives each variant. For a simple A/B test, a 50/50 split is common. However, if you’re testing a particularly risky or unproven variant, you might do an 80/20 split, sending the control to 80% and the variant to 20%.
- Set Goal Metric: Crucially, define your success metric. For push notifications, this is almost always “Click-Through Rate.” Some platforms might offer “Conversion Rate” if you’ve integrated conversion tracking deeply enough.
- Specify Test Duration or Sample Size: This is critical for statistical significance. Don’t end a test too early! Many platforms will recommend a minimum audience size or duration. For a client last year, we were testing a new discount code format. We aimed for 95% statistical significance with a minimum detectable effect of 2%. The platform (which I won’t name here, but it’s a popular one) calculated we needed at least 15,000 users per variant. We ran the test for five days to ensure we hit that user count across our segmented audience of “lapsed subscribers.”
- Schedule and Launch: Double-check everything, then schedule your test. Make sure you’re sending at an optimal time for your audience; this is a whole other A/B test in itself!

5. Monitor Results and Ensure Statistical Significance
Once your test is live, resist the urge to declare a winner too soon. You need enough data to be confident that your observed difference isn’t just random chance. This is where statistical significance comes in. Most platforms will calculate this for you, showing a confidence level (e.g., 90%, 95%, 99%).
I personally aim for at least 95% statistical significance before making a decision. Anything less, and you might be making changes based on noise. For example, if Variant B has a 10% higher CTR than Variant A, but the significance is only 70%, I’d let the test run longer or reconsider the results. Case Study: Enhancing E-commerce Engagement
Last year, I worked with an e-commerce client selling custom home decor. Their push notification CTRs were stagnant around 3%. We hypothesized that adding a personalized product recommendation directly into the push notification, rather than a generic category link, would improve engagement. We segmented their audience into “users who recently browsed Product Category X but didn’t purchase.”
Variant A (Control): “New arrivals in home decor! Shop now for unique pieces.” (Generic link to category page)
Variant B (Test): “👋 [First Name], we think you’ll love this [Specific Product Name]! Get yours.” (Deep link to a personalized product page they recently viewed)
We ran the test for 7 days, distributing to 20,000 users per variant. The results were compelling: Variant A achieved a 3.2% CTR, while Variant B hit a remarkable 7.8% CTR. This represented a 144% increase in CTR, with 98% statistical significance. The personalized approach clearly resonated. We immediately implemented Variant B as the default for this segment, leading to a sustained increase in their push notification-driven sales by 15% over the following month.
6. Analyze, Implement, and Iterate
Once you have a statistically significant winner, it’s time to take action. Implement the winning variation as your default for that specific audience segment and notification type. But don’t stop there. A/B testing is an ongoing process, not a one-off task.
Every successful test should lead to your next hypothesis. For instance, if adding emojis worked, perhaps testing different types of emojis (e.g., celebratory vs. urgent) is the next step. If personalization was a hit, maybe personalizing the offer itself (e.g., “Here’s 10% off [Specific Product Name] just for you!”) could yield even better results.
Document your findings meticulously. What worked? What didn’t? Why do you think that was the case? This institutional knowledge is invaluable. I maintain a detailed spreadsheet for all A/B tests, noting the hypothesis, variants, audience, duration, results (CTR, conversions, significance), and key takeaways. This helps us avoid repeating failed tests and quickly identify patterns across different campaigns.

What is the ideal sample size for A/B testing push notifications?
The ideal sample size depends on your desired statistical significance, the baseline CTR, and the minimum detectable effect you’re looking for. Many platforms will calculate this for you, but generally, you need thousands of users per variant to achieve reliable results (e.g., 95% confidence). Don’t run tests on fewer than 1,000 users per variant if you expect meaningful insights.
How long should I run an A/B test for push notifications?
Run your test until you achieve statistical significance, or for a minimum of 24 to 72 hours to account for different user behaviors throughout the day and week. If your audience is small, you might need to run it for a full week or more. Ending too early often leads to misleading results.
Can I A/B test more than two variations (A/B/C testing)?
Yes, many platforms support A/B/n testing. However, be cautious. Each additional variant requires a larger overall audience size to maintain statistical significance. I recommend starting with A/B tests to isolate variables, then moving to more complex A/B/C tests once you have a clear understanding of individual element impacts.
What are common elements to A/B test in push notifications?
Common elements include the headline/title, body copy, call to action (CTA) text, emoji usage, image/rich media, timing of delivery, personalization (e.g., first name, product recommendation), and urgency/scarcity messaging. Always test one primary element at a time.
What if my A/B test shows no significant difference?
If your test shows no statistically significant difference, it means neither variant performed demonstrably better than the other. This isn’t a failure! It’s a valuable insight that the change you introduced didn’t move the needle. Revert to the control (or the simpler variant) and formulate a new hypothesis to test a different element. Sometimes, “no difference” is still a valuable piece of data for future strategies.
